1. Component Design: The LQW32FT470M0HL is a two-terminal inductor, consisting of an input and an output terminal. This design simplifies the integration of the inductor into various electronic circuit layouts, offering a straightforward alternative to more complex multi-pin components.
2. Circuit Integration Technique: To integrate the LQW32FT470M0HL into an electronic circuit, it is necessary to solder its two terminals onto a printed circuit board (PCB). These non-polarized terminals allow for flexibility in the inductor's placement and orientation within the circuit design.
3. Surface-Mount Technology (SMT) Compatibility: The LQW32FT470M0HL is designed for SMT, making it suitable for modern, high-density PCB assemblies. Adherence to SMT best practices, including precision in soldering and effective thermal management, is crucial to maintain the inductor's performance and durability.
4. Functional Role in Electronic Circuits: In electronic circuits, the LQW32FT470M0HL serves as a component for filtering and power regulation. It is typically used in power supply circuits or other applications where managing high current and minimizing EMI is important, enhancing the stability and efficiency of the overall system.
5. Electrical Specifications: When designing circuits with the LQW32FT470M0HL, it's important to consider its inductance value, current handling capacity, and DC resistance. These specifications are crucial in determining the inductor's performance in high-current applications and its effectiveness in noise filtration.
6. Thermal Management in PCB Design: Proper thermal management within the PCB design is vital for the LQW32FT470M0HL, especially since it is designed to handle high currents. Ensuring adequate space for heat dissipation and using appropriate cooling methods is important to maintain the inductor's integrity and performance.
7. Strategic Placement on PCB: The placement of the LQW32FT470M0HL on a PCB is crucial, particularly in applications where managing EMI is essential. Strategic positioning can help to minimize interaction with other components and reduce potential interference in the circuit.
In summary, the LQW32FT470M0HL is a crucial inductor for high-current power management and noise reduction in various electronic circuits. Effective integration of this inductor into a circuit requires careful consideration of connection methods, electrical characteristics, thermal management, and strategic placement on the PCB. When these factors are attentively managed, the LQW32FT470M0HL can significantly enhance the performance and reliability of electronic devices and systems.
